Published on May 11, 2011 By Jitendra

Idioms and phrases and their use in the English language is widespread. Those who want to master the English language need to know the various idioms which are commonly used and their meanings. Idioms are usually small phrases of words which do not mean what the words literally mean. The phrase usually, in the light […]